Output ff6152357d13bc825c87fc0fe90168bfa2b2326e27e5da7e2cd99eacb06cd264:1

value
26368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3941cfcfc012d06ee584e6944d7ffa839f426b39 OP_EQUAL
address
36umHAD9JN4ER2h9YX835qRUyM3kD1kWCa
transaction
ff6152357d13bc825c87fc0fe90168bfa2b2326e27e5da7e2cd99eacb06cd264
confirmations
234935
spent
true